Planets and Children (The Niche Masterpiece) Best for: Advanced practitioners handling fertility and adoption cases. Why it is unique: This is not a general astrology book. It focuses entirely on the 5th house (Children) and the 9th house (Fortune/Luck linked to progeny). Rao studied over 200 charts of childless couples, couples with multiple children, and families with adopted children. Keywords integrated: K N Rao books, Vedic Astrology,

Taming the Untamed: Astrology of Unexplained & Unsolved Mysteries Best for: Those who think astrology is too simple. Why it is a cult classic: This book moves away from daily life (job, marriage, money) and into the bizarre. Rao analyzes the horoscopes of serial killers (like Jeffrey Dahmer), historical tyrants, and cases of premature death (like Princess Diana).
